Output 124477cf7eab6a45b54018251ffaa585db6ee8fef59d996efd39b8cad06eff2e:6

value
29865957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9997e3a3efa73d3e49082166bbcfbf96dd8ed574 OP_EQUAL
address
MMuHaECBHvEphyzzCFk8f1mF2H2SkyvJ5g
transaction
124477cf7eab6a45b54018251ffaa585db6ee8fef59d996efd39b8cad06eff2e
spent
true